Dhurandhar worldwide collection day 12: Box office update
The film opened to a thunderous Rs 28 crore and has since sustained an enviable streak of Rs 20 crore-plus days. Though it faced bans in six Gulf countries over alleged anti-Pakistan sentiments, Indian audiences remained unfazed. In fact, its overseas performance only strengthened the film’s standing as one of Bollywood’s biggest year-end successes.
As per Sacnilk, Dhurandhar surged past Rs 30 crore on its first Saturday and peaked at Rs 43 crore on debut Sunday, crossing Rs 100 crore within just three days. While Monday brought a predictable 45 per cent dip, collections bounced back quickly. By the end of the first week, the film had touched Rs 207 crore domestically. The second weekend pushed things even further, with Rs 32 crore on Friday and a massive Rs 53 crore on day nine. India collections now hover close to Rs 381 crore, while worldwide earnings have climbed to more than Rs 580 crore, including Rs 130 crore from international markets alone.
Domestically, Dhurandhar grossed another Rs 30 crore to take the Indian box office by a storm to collect Rs 411 crore. Directed by Uri: The Surgical Strike filmmaker Aditya Dhar, Dhurandhar now sits comfortably among 2025’s biggest Bollywood hits, alongside Chhaava and Saiyaara.
